Meltonby is a hamlet in the East Riding of Yorkshire. It’s situated approximately 2 miles north of Pocklington and together with the village of Yapham forms the civil parish of Yapham cum Meltonby.

In 1949 the Wellington aircraft from Middleton St. George co. Durham crashed in a grass field at Grange farm in the hamlet.
